dt-bindings: extcon: linux,extcon-usb-gpio: GPIO must be provided

Without providing either ID or VBUS GPIO the driver is not able to operate.
Original text binding says:
  "Either one of id-gpio or vbus-gpio must be present."

Fixes: 79a31ce03f41 ("dt-bindings: extcon: convert extcon-usb-gpio.txt to yaml format")
